File tree Expand file tree Collapse file tree
java/org/soujava/demos/jakarta Expand file tree Collapse file tree Original file line number Diff line number Diff line change 1515import jakarta .enterprise .inject .se .SeContainer ;
1616import jakarta .enterprise .inject .se .SeContainerInitializer ;
1717import net .datafaker .Faker ;
18- import org .eclipse .jnosql .mapping .document .DocumentTemplate ;
1918
20- import java .util .List ;
21- import java .util .Set ;
2219import java .util .logging .Logger ;
2320
2421
@@ -29,6 +26,10 @@ public class App {
2926 public static void main (String [] args ) {
3027 var faker = new Faker ();
3128 try (SeContainer container = SeContainerInitializer .newInstance ().initialize ()) {
29+ var repository = container .select (Garage .class ).get ();
30+
31+ var vehicle = Vehicle .of (faker );
32+ repository .save (vehicle );
3233
3334 }
3435 }
Original file line number Diff line number Diff line change 1+ package org .soujava .demos .jakarta ;
2+
3+ import jakarta .data .repository .BasicRepository ;
4+ import jakarta .data .repository .Repository ;
5+
6+
7+ @ Repository
8+ public interface Garage extends BasicRepository <Vehicle , String > {
9+ }
Original file line number Diff line number Diff line change 88#
99# You may elect to redistribute this code under either of these licenses.
1010#
11- jnosql.document.database =olympus
11+ jnosql.document.database =cars
1212jnosql.mongodb.url =mongodb://localhost:27017
You can’t perform that action at this time.
0 commit comments